I think the point is, like it is for me, you don't necessarily have any appointments for today, but for tomorrow or later than that, and would like to have a reminder visible couple of days beforehand.
 
Posts: 5 | Thanked: 0 times | Joined on May 2008
#4
The other point, implied by Snoshrk, was that you can tell GPE Summary roughly how many upcoming appointments you want to see. If there aren't enough today it will show tomorrow as well, and so on. It isn't quite the same as showing N days, but at least for some uses it's good enough.
